USAGE SUMMARY

"have a basic familiarity" is a grammatically correct and usable phrase in written English.
You can use it to refer to having a basic understanding or knowledge of something. For example: "Before starting the course, I wanted to make sure I had a basic familiarity with the material."

Expert writing Tips

Best practice

When using "have a basic familiarity", clearly specify the subject or area to which the familiarity applies. For example, "have a basic familiarity with programming languages" is more informative than simply "have a basic familiarity".

Common error

Avoid using "have a basic familiarity" when you actually possess in-depth knowledge. This phrase indicates a foundational understanding, not expertise.

FAQs

How can I use "have a basic familiarity" in a sentence?

You can use "have a basic familiarity" to indicate a general understanding of a topic, as in "Students should "have a basic familiarity" with linear algebra before taking the course".

What's a good alternative to "have a basic familiarity"?

Alternatives include "possess a rudimentary understanding", "have a working knowledge", or "be acquainted with" depending on the nuance you want to convey.

Is it better to say "have basic familiarity" or "have a basic familiarity"?

While "have basic familiarity" might be understood, ""have a basic familiarity"" is grammatically more correct and commonly used.

What level of knowledge does "have a basic familiarity" imply?

It suggests a foundational level of knowledge, enough to understand fundamental concepts but not necessarily enough for advanced application or detailed discussion.
